BASEBALL WINTER MEETINGS
Las Vegas, NV. 12/08/08

The Baseball Winter Meetings are an annual December gathering of professional baseball executives open only to major and minor league members, Baseball Trade Show exhibitors, participants at the Professional Baseball Employment Opportunities job fair, media and affiliated parties. There have been over 100 Baseball Winter Meetings in the event's history, and 2008 marked the first time Las Vegas was selected to host the largest baseball related trade show in the world.

The Latino presence goes beyond their participation as attendees and exhibitors in these meetings. For the first time in professional baseball, an all-Latino team of baseball players, the Latin Stars, has been announced among those who have a voice in the sports network. This team will travel with the US Military All Stars across United States to play against professional teams in over 40 cities.
The Latin Stars is operated by Boston Baseball All-Stars, a revolutionary enterprise that currently owns five teams, including the US Military All Stars, the Pittsfield American Defenders, and the American Defenders of New Hampshire, among others.
